The St. Catherine's Saints will be playing in front of their home fans against the St. Margaret's Scotties at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. The timing is sure in St. Catherine's favor as the squad sits on 18 straight wins at home (dating back to last season) while St. Margaret's has been banged up by nine consecutive losses on the road dating back to last season.
On Friday, St. Catherine's was able to grind out a solid win over Fredericksburg Christian, taking the game 5-2.
Kinnady Branch sp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ered just two earned runs on five hits and racked up seven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't pitched less than five innings in 13 consecutive pitching appearances.
At the plate, the team relied heavily on Day Vetter, who went 3-for-4 with two stolen bases and two RBI. Another player making a difference was Brianna Henry, who sc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-4.
St. Margaret's lost 18-1 to Grace Christian School on Friday.
St. Catherine's victory bumped their record up to 16-2. As for St. Margaret's, their loss dropped their record down to 0-9.
Everything went St. Catherine's way against St. Margaret's when the teams last played last Thursday as St. Catherine's made off with a 19-0 win. Does St. Catherine's have another victory up their sleeve, or will St. Margaret's tur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
